Bara Gopinathpur Village

Bara Gopinathpur is an inhabited village in Khandaghosh Block of Barddhaman district, West Bengal. Its Census village code is 320948, the Census 2011 record lists 1,774 people in 367 households and the reported area is 244.44 hectares. The local references include Khandaghosh CD Block and the nearest town reference is Burdwan at about 20 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 1,774 people in 367 households, with 899 male residents and 875 female residents. The average household size is 4.83, and SC share is 51.8% and ST share is 3.04% for Bara Gopinathpur. Population density works out to about 725.74 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Bara Gopinathpur show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 201.85 hectares and irrigated land is 201.85 hectares (100%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
